epoxidized soybean oil 8013-07-8,epoxidized soybean oil (ESBO) is used as a plasticizer and stabilizer in plastic materials, especially pvc and its copolymers to keep these plastics soft and pliable. the chemical is also used as a pigment dispersing agent and acid/mercaptan scavenging agent as well as an epoxy reactive diluent.
epoxidized soybean oil serves as an effective plasticizer in a wide range of applications, including pvc flooring, wire and cable insulation, flex banners , leather cloth , films, automotive parts, and medical devices. it imparts flexibility, durability, and resilience to these products.

- How is Epoxidized Soybean Oil (ESBO) produced?
- The production of epoxidized soybean oil involves several key steps: Raw materials: The primary raw material for ESBO production is soybean oil, which is abundant and renewable. Epoxidation: Soybean oil undergoes a chemical process called epoxidation, where the double bonds in the oil’s molecular structure are converted into epoxy groups.

- How does epoxidation of soybean oil affect Esbo?
- The epoxidation of soybean oil results in the formation of an oxirane ring at the location of carbon-carbon double bonds originally present in the unsaturated fatty acids. This confers new reactivity to ESBO that allows it to function as a reactive plasticizer and modifier.
